  • Cars 3 Release Date: June 16, 2017

    Posted on the PCD Facebook group a few days ago by Melissa Staley:


    and confirmed by Met on TakeFiveADay this past Friday... The theatrical release of Cars3 has been moved up to June 16, 2017.
